Important Disclaimer

This calculator uses the official 2023 North Carolina Schedule of Basic Child Support Obligations (AOC-A-162, effective January 1, 2023) and is for informational purposes only. It does not constitute legal advice. Actual support orders set by the court may differ based on extraordinary expenses, imputed income, voluntary unemployment, deviation from the guidelines, and other case-specific circumstances.
